Hi, I want to use XPath Expressions on a HTML page. I use JTidy to convert a page into XHTML. This XHTML can be easily transformed into a dom4j Document. My current problem is that I get a NullPointerException if I try to access any Node in the page using a XPath Expression. I don't understand why...
